Intended Use
Silver Alginate II Dressing is indicated for the management of moderate to heavily exuding partial to full thickness wounds, including: Post-operative wounds Trauma wounds Leg Ulcers Pressures Ulcers Diabetic Ulcers Graft and donor sites. Silver Alginate II Dressing is indicated for external use only.
Device Story
Sterile, non-woven wound dressing; composed of high G calcium alginate, carboxymethylcellulose (CMC), and ionic silver complex (Silver Sodium Hydrogen Zirconium Phosphate). Absorbs wound fluid to form gel; maintains moist environment; allows intact removal. Releases silver ions to provide antimicrobial barrier against broad spectrum of microorganisms for up to 21 days. Reduces odor via antibacterial effect. Used in clinical or home settings for wound management; applied by healthcare providers or patients. Benefits include infection reduction, odor control, and optimal healing environment.
Clinical Evidence
Bench testing only. Biocompatibility testing performed per BS EN ISO 10993-1. In-vitro testing and microbiological assessment demonstrated antimicrobial efficacy and performance characteristics equivalent to predicate devices.

Device Description:-Silver Alginate II Dressing is a sterile, non woven pad composed of a high G (guluronic acid) calcium alginate, carboxymethylcellulose (CMC) and ionic silver complex (Silver Sodium Hydrogen Zirconium Phosphate), which releases silver ions in the presence of wound fluid. As wound fluid is absorbed the alginate forms a gel, which assists in maintaining a moist environment for optimal wound healing, and allows intact removal. The silver ions protect the dressing from a broad spectrum of microorganisms over a period of up to twenty-one (21) days, based on in-vitro testing. . Odour reduction results from the antibacterial effect in the dressing. Silver Alginate II Dressing is an effective barrier to bacterial penetration. The barrier function of the dressing may help to reduce infection in moderate to heavily exuding partial to full thickness wounds. The dressing has an off-white appearance and is available in various sizes (5cm x 5cm, 10cm x 10cm, 15cm x 15cm, 10cm x 20cm, 20cm x 30cm flat dressings; 2.7cm x 30cm and 3cm x 44cm flat rope dressings; and 30cm x 2g rope dressings). The flat rope dressings are packaged in pouches and the flat rope and rope dressings are packaged in a blister pack.

| Testing:- | The biocompatibility of Advanced Medical Solutions<br>Limited Silver Alginate II Dressing has been demonstrated<br>to be in compliance with the requirements of BS EN ISO<br>10993-1. Additional in-vitro testing and additional<br>microbiological assessment has demonstrated that the key<br>performance characteristics of the dressing are substantially<br>equivalent to the predicate devices. |
|----------------------------------------------|-------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------|
| Statement of:-<br>Substantial<br>Equivalence | The Silver Alginate II Dressing is a non-woven calcium<br>alginate dressing which is substantially equivalent in<br>construction and/or performance to both Anticoat® Calcium<br>Alginate Dressing and Aquacel Ag absorbent antimicrobial<br>wound dressing predicate devices. Comparable<br>absorbency, silver release profile and antimicrobial activity<br>have been demonstrated. |
